Hi, I've been noticing lately that my network link sometimes does not go up after a suspend resume cycle (roughly 1 or 2 out of 10 times). This also sometimes happens with a fresh boot too. Doing a manual "ip link set down/up" cycle resolves this issue.
I was able to bisect it to the commit below (or hope so) and also CCed the maintainer for my driver too. This is happening on a up-to-date Arch Linux system with a Intel I219-V.
